Rodrigo Javier De Paul is a prominent Argentine professional football player recognized for his role as a central midfielder. He currently plays for La Liga club Atlético Madrid. Furthermore, De Paul is a key member of the Argentina national team, contributing significantly to their midfield. His career is defined by skill and impact at both club and international levels.
In June 2012, Rodrigo De Paul was called up to Racing Club's main squad for a match against Vélez Sarsfield, while still a junior, but he remained unused during the game.
In February 2013, Rodrigo De Paul played his first professional match, substituting Mauro Camoranesi in a 0–3 loss at Atlético de Rafaela.
In May 2014, Valencia CF agreed to a US$6.5 million deal for Rodrigo De Paul with Racing Club.
In December 2014, Rodrigo De Paul scored his first goal for Valencia CF in a 2–1 win against Rayo Vallecano in the Copa del Rey.
In April 2015, Rodrigo De Paul scored his first La Liga goal against Athletic Bilbao.
In February 2016, Valencia manager Gary Neville loaned Rodrigo De Paul to his former side Racing Club.
In July 2016, Rodrigo De Paul was transferred to Italian Serie A club Udinese.
In August 2016, Rodrigo De Paul debuted for Udinese against AS Roma in a 4–0 defeat.
In January 2017, Rodrigo De Paul scored his first goal for Udinese against AC Milan in a 2–1 victory.
In 2018, Rodrigo De Paul started the season with four goals in the first six matches of the Serie A season.
In October 2019, Rodrigo De Paul signed a new five-year contract at Udinese.
In December 2020, Rodrigo De Paul became Udinese's club captain, replacing Kevin Lasagna.
In July 2021, Rodrigo De Paul signed a five-year contract with Atlético Madrid after winning the Copa América with Argentina.
In December 2021, Rodrigo De Paul scored his first goal for Atlético Madrid in a 3–1 away win against FC Porto in the UEFA Champions League.
Rodrigo De Paul was part of the squad that won the 2022 FIFA World Cup.
Rodrigo De Paul was part of the squad that won the 2024 Copa América.
